Technique Tip for This Smoothie
When you’re making this Kale Pineapple Smoothie, one simple trick that really helps is how you add the ingredients to the blender. It might seem like you can just toss everything in any order, but doing it a certain way makes blending easier and smoother. Here’s how I like to do it:
- Start by putting the liquids in first—in this case, the coconut water. This gives the blades something to move around right away.
- Next, add the softer fruits, like the ripe banana and the diced pineapple.
- Finally, add the chopped kale on top.
Why does this order help? When the liquid is at the bottom, it helps the blades spin freely and pull the other ingredients down. If you put the kale or other greens in first, they can get stuck under the blades or just swirl around without blending well. This way, everything gets mixed evenly and you end up with a smooth, creamy smoothie without any big chunks.

Alternative Ingredients
kale - Substitute with spinach: Spinach has a milder flavor and similar nutritional benefits, making it a great alternative for a smoothie.
pineapple - Substitute with mango: Mango provides a similar tropical sweetness and creamy texture, which complements the other ingredients in the smoothie.
coconut water - Substitute with almond milk: Almond milk adds a nutty flavor and creamy consistency, while still keeping the smoothie light and refreshing.
banana - Substitute with avocado: Avocado offers a creamy texture and healthy fats, providing a similar consistency to the smoothie without the sweetness of a banana.

How to Store or Freeze Your Smoothie
To keep your kale pineapple smoothie fresh and vibrant, store it in an airtight container. A mason jar with a tight-fitting lid works wonders. This will help maintain the smoothie’s delightful flavor and prevent any unwanted fridge odors from sneaking in.
If you plan to enjoy your smoothie later in the day, pop it in the fridge. It should stay fresh for up to 24 hours. Give it a good shake or stir before sipping to mix any settled ingredients.
For those who love to plan ahead, freezing is your best friend. Pour the smoothie into ice cube trays, leaving a little room for expansion. Once frozen, transfer the cubes into a freezer-safe bag or container. This method allows you to blend a quick smoothie by simply adding a few cubes to your blender with a splash of coconut water.
If you prefer to freeze the entire smoothie, pour it into a freezer-safe jar or container, leaving some space at the top. When you're ready to enjoy, let it thaw in the fridge overnight. A quick blend in the morning will bring it back to its creamy, dreamy state.
For an on-the-go option, freeze the smoothie in a reusable squeeze pouch. This is perfect for a quick breakfast or snack, and it will thaw by lunchtime, ready to be enjoyed.
Remember, the texture might change slightly after freezing, but the taste of pineapple and banana will still be as delightful as ever.

Time-Saving Tips for This Smoothie
Prep ingredients in advance: Wash and chop the kale and dice the pineapple ahead of time. Store them in airtight containers in the fridge.
Use frozen fruits: Keep a stash of frozen pineapple and banana in your freezer. This not only saves time but also makes your smoothie extra cold and refreshing.
Batch blend: Double or triple the smoothie recipe and store the extra in the fridge for up to two days. Just give it a quick stir before serving.
Quick cleanup: Rinse the blender immediately after use to prevent any residue from sticking.

Kale Pineapple Smoothie
Ingredients
Main Ingredients
- 1 cup kale chopped
- 1 cup pineapple diced
- 1 cup coconut water
- 1 piece banana ripe
Instructions
- Add all ingredients to a blender.
- Blend until smooth.
- Pour into glasses and serve immediately.
